Analyst: Strong VR interest from US businesses
August 17, 2017
Virtual Reality (VR) is often viewed through the lens of consumer-driven gaming, but in a recent B2B technology survey of 455 US-based companies across nine vertical markets, ABI Research finds that while only 4 per cent of respondents have VR in operation, 85 per cent are at least in the stages of early investigation.
